The PatchMap Family of Products

The PatchMap family consists of 6 products - all with a different focus, but maintaning the common theme of providing highly-detailed maps and easy-to-use functionality. Whether you're dispatching from the office, or in the deep bush with no phone service, the PatchMap family has a option suitable for your needs.

All PatchMap products include our comprehensive wellsite, LSD, and facility searches, and all utilize our custom navigation on our unmatched oilfield road data to get you heading in the right direction.

PatchMap for MapSource (PC 2.0)

This version of PatchMap is for full off-line use. It runs on the deprecated Garmin program called MapSource via a small program that we wrote so that there can be communications with the modern versions of Garmins. This version leverages nRoute (sister program to MapSource) for navigating … it needs a USB 18 GPS to be able to use it as a large screen GPS. This is still a popular version for those who need the real deal out in the bush. Pricing is a subscription and is the same for all three PC versions of PatchMap so if one doesn’t work for you, another one will and we simply activate/deactivate appropriately. See more here.

Runs on Windows (all versions), No internet access required
